Real-Time Personalization in SaaS: How It Works
Real-time personalization in SaaS transforms user experiences instantly by adapting content, features, and interfaces based on live user behavior and context. This approach boosts engagement, increases conversion rates, and enables data-driven decisions. Here's how it works:
- Types of Data Used: Behavioral (clicks, session length), demographic (location, industry), and contextual (device, browser).
- Tools and Systems: Platforms like Mixpanel and Optiblack centralize and analyze data for actionable insights.
- AI and ML: Predictive analytics and real-time engines deliver tailored recommendations and optimize user journeys.
- Key Benefits: Improved trial-to-paid conversions, higher user retention, and significant revenue growth (e.g., a 102% MRR increase for TaxplanIQ).
Data Collection Methods
Data Categories
Real-time personalization depends on gathering a variety of data points to provide actionable insights. SaaS platforms typically focus on three main types of data:
Behavioral Data
- Navigation patterns
- Frequency of feature use
- Time spent on specific functions
- Click behavior
- Session length
Demographic Data
- Company size and industry
- User roles
- Geographic location
- Technology preferences
- Team structure
Contextual Data
- Type of device used
- Browser details
- Time zone and language settings
- Internet connection speed
- Login frequency
SaaS platforms rely on advanced tools to gather and process user data effectively. Optiblack is a standout example, managing data for over 19 million users across more than 45 applications [1].
"Optiblack helped us in deciding the right ICP to go after for our Go To Market and built our entire data stack." - Jean-Paul Klerks, Chief Growth Officer, Luna [1]
An effective data collection system typically includes:
Analytics Integration
Platforms like Mixpanel are highly effective for SaaS companies. A satisfied client shared:
"Team Optiblack understands Mixpanel & Analytics really well. Their onboarding support cut down our implementation efforts." - Tapan Patel, VP Initiatives, Tvito [1]
Data Consolidation
Combining data from multiple sources into a centralized system creates a complete view of user behavior. This approach allows companies to:
- Follow user journeys across different touchpoints
- Detect patterns in feature adoption
- Track real-time engagement and conversion metrics
- Analyze conversion rates at various stages
These systems not only simplify data management but also ensure secure and efficient data processing.
Data Privacy Standards
Compliance Requirements
- GDPR for users in Europe
- CCPA for California residents
- Industry-specific regulations
- Policies for data retention
- Managing user consent
Security Measures
- End-to-end encryption
- Routine security audits
- Access control protocols
- Data anonymization techniques
- Secure storage solutions
This framework ensures that personalization efforts are both effective and compliant, maintaining user trust while enabling real-time data processing.
Real-Time Data Processing
Processing Infrastructure
SaaS platforms rely on efficient systems to manage real-time data. These systems are built around several core components:
- Stream Processing and Storage: Handles event streaming and distributed processing.
- In-Memory Computing: Balances loads to ensure smooth operations.
- Time-Series Databases: Useful for analyzing trends and patterns over time.
- Document Stores and Cache Layers: Manage user profiles and deliver quick access to data.
- Data Warehouses: Store historical data for deeper analysis.
With real-time processing, teams can quickly respond to user behavior and platform performance, making smarter decisions faster.
AI and ML Applications
Once the infrastructure is in place, AI and ML tools turn raw data into actionable insights. Here's how they contribute:
- Predictive Analytics: These tools forecast user behavior, predict churn rates, track feature adoption, and analyze usage trends.
- Real-Time Decision Engines: Enable dynamic content delivery, optimize user journeys, offer personalized recommendations, and adjust feature visibility.
These AI-driven strategies lead to noticeable boosts in user engagement and conversion rates for SaaS platforms.
User Segmentation Methods
AI insights help refine user segmentation, making personalization even more effective. Segmentation typically focuses on two key areas:
- Behavioral Segments: Includes usage patterns, engagement metrics, feature adoption levels, and activity trends over time.
- Value-Based Segments: Focuses on customer lifetime value, account health, and growth or utilization metrics.
For example, TaxplanIQ saw a 102% jump in Monthly Recurring Revenue by applying precise segmentation [1].
The Product Head at Assetplus highlighted the importance of a strong data foundation:
"Love how much effort Optiblack put in getting our data tech stack ready for Assetplus, like they really want to build a business and they are not transactional" [1].
Implementing Personalization
Content Personalization
Real-time content personalization depends on having a strong data setup. Some key areas to focus on include:
- User Journey Optimization: Adjusting content based on how users behave and their past interactions.
- Feature Discovery: Showcasing features that match user habits and preferences.
- Engagement Timing: Sharing content when users are most likely to engage with it.
To enhance this experience, customizing the interface can make user interactions even smoother.
Interface Customization
Personalization goes beyond just content. Customizing the user interface helps create user-friendly experiences that improve efficiency. Important factors include:
- Streamlining workflows to fit specific user roles.
- Providing quick access to commonly used features.
- Adjusting visual layouts to match individual preferences.
Putting It All Together
For personalization to succeed, you need a solid data infrastructure, AI-driven automation, and regular performance reviews. This strategy has delivered impressive results for SaaS platforms, such as a 102% boost in Monthly Recurring Revenue [1].
Drive SaaS Engagement and Usage with Real-Time Data
Tracking performance is key to refining strategies and achieving measurable results, especially when using a data-driven personalization approach.
Success Metrics
Focus on metrics that directly influence user engagement, conversions, and revenue. Companies using real-time personalization often monitor:
- User Engagement: Metrics like session duration, feature adoption rates, and interaction frequency.
- Conversions: Rates for trial-to-paid conversions and upgrades to premium features.
- Revenue Impact: Changes in Monthly Recurring Revenue (MRR) and customer lifetime value.
- Retention: Churn rate reduction and user satisfaction scores.
Testing Methods
Once key metrics are identified, testing is essential to measure their effectiveness. A/B testing is a common method for evaluating personalization strategies.
Baseline Testing
- A control group experiences the standard setup.
- A test group interacts with personalized features.
- Tests typically run for 2-4 weeks to achieve statistical significance.
Segmentation Testing
- Tests different personalization strategies across user segments.
- Measures the impact on specific behaviors.
- Analyzes conversion trends within each segment.
These tests confirm whether personalization strategies are effective. After validation, models need regular updates to maintain performance.
Model Updates
AI and machine learning models driving personalization must be continually refined to stay effective. The update process includes:
Data Analysis
- Regularly reviewing performance data.
- Identifying shifts in patterns.
- Analyzing trends in user behavior.
Model Refinement
- Adding new data points to improve insights.
- Adjusting algorithms based on observed performance.
- Fine-tuning models for better prediction accuracy.
"Optiblack helped us in deciding the right ICP to go after for our Go To Market and built our entire data stack." - Jean-Paul Klerks, Chief Growth Officer, Luna [1]
To ensure personalization efforts remain effective, companies should:
- Define clear AI use cases through proof-of-concept (POC) projects.
- Develop a well-thought-out generative AI vision.
- Regularly assess business goals against model performance.
- Adjust models based on real-world performance data.
Next Steps
Refine your strategy using proven performance metrics and modernize your data systems to enhance real-time personalization.

Collaborate with experts like Optiblack to improve personalization efforts and achieve measurable outcomes. Optiblack simplifies the journey from data collection to actionable insights, using a data-driven approach.
Key Implementation Steps:
-
Data Infrastructure Assessment
Use Optiblack's Data Accelerator service to evaluate your current data systems.
-
Technical Team Alignment
Ensure your team is equipped to make data-driven decisions. Mo Malayeri, CEO of Bettermode, shared his experience:
"We wanted to get the best brain in the market, who knows what they are doing, we first came across the content and decided to go with Optiblack for the process they have. Now we look at data every day and every week to make business decisions and to move in the right direction..." [1]
-
Performance Optimization
Metrics from real-world use cases demonstrate the results:
Metric |
Achievement |
MRR Growth |
102% increase for TaxplanIQ [1] |
Trial Conversion |
20% improvement in 1 week for Dictanote [1] |
Process Efficiency |
Up to 90% improvement via AI solutions [1] |
Three-Phase Approach:
- Exploration and Requirements Gathering: Understand your needs and set clear goals.
- Solution Architecture and Team Planning: Design the system and align your team for success.
- Continuous Monitoring and Optimization: Regularly assess performance and make improvements.
"Working with this Optiblack has been a total breeze for us at Piktochart. They've been our go-to experts for setting up tracking and dashboards, and they've given us some seriously valuable insights that have made our analytics super smooth and actionable." – Girithara Ramanan, UX Head, Piktochart [1]
These steps establish a strong foundation for sustained personalization, backed by secure data governance and clear optimization practices.